Kathryn Tickell comes Nettlebed


8/10/2008

The Northumbrian piper Kathryn Tickell will be bringing her celebrated band to Nettlebed on Monday.

Kathryn is the foremost exponent of the Northumbrian pipes and has played with Sting, The Chieftains, The Penguin Café Orchestra, Evelyn Glennie and many others as well as releasing 14 of her own albums.

She learned in the traditional way from old shepherd musicians in outlying hill farms in Northumberland.

Her personal evocation of the Northumbrian landscape and its people has reached audiences all over the world.

Earlier this year, the BBC Proms gave the world premiere of one of her compositions.

She will be bringing Julian Sutton on melodeon, Peter Tickell on fiddle and guitar and Joss Clapp on guitar and bass with her to the Village Club in High Street.

Doors open at 8pm and tickets at £12.50 are available from the box office on 01628 636620.
